Ordinals
beta
Sat 1357067784710422
decimal
332827.284710422
degree
0°122827′187″284710422‴
percentile
64.62227553348558%
name
efuprwcjzax
cycle
0
epoch
1
period
165
block
332827
offset
284710422
timestamp
2014-12-04 10:05:11 UTC
rarity
common
prev
next